Stacker-reclaimers are critical machines used in bulk material handling, particularly in industries like mining, cement, and power generation. These machines are designed to stack materials like coal, iron ore, or limestone in large stockpiles and reclaim them efficiently when needed. Given the size, complexity, and constant motion of the machinery, proper maintenance is essential for operational efficiency. One key component that plays a significant role in ensuring reliable performance is the split bearing.

Why Split Bearings Are Ideal for Stacker-Reclaimers
1. Heavy Load Handling
Stacker-reclaimers involve rotating parts like the slewing drive, which experiences significant radial and axial loads. Split bearings are built to handle these heavy loads, especially in demanding conditions such as high-speed rotation and exposure to dust, heat, and moisture.

2. Ease of Maintenance
One of the standout benefits of split bearings is the ease of maintenance. In a stacker-reclaimer, the rotating parts can be difficult to access, making traditional bearing replacement a complicated and time-consuming process. With split bearings, maintenance crews can replace or service the bearings without fully dismantling the components, minimizing downtime and reducing labor costs.

3. Reduced Downtime and Increased Productivity
Given the critical nature of stacker-reclaimers in material handling operations, any downtime can lead to significant operational losses. Split bearings help to mitigate this risk by simplifying the process of replacing worn bearings. The faster a bearing can be swapped out, the less downtime is incurred, leading to increased productivity and a more efficient workflow.

4. Durability in Harsh Environments
Stacker-reclaimers often operate in environments where dust, dirt, and debris are prevalent, not to mention high humidity and fluctuating temperatures. Split bearings are designed with robust sealing systems that protect against contaminants, thus extending the lifespan of the bearing and reducing the need for frequent replacements.

5. Cost-Effectiveness
While split bearings may have a higher initial cost compared to traditional bearings, their long-term benefits—reduced downtime, lower labor costs, and extended bearing life—make them a cost-effective choice in the long run. By preventing operational disruptions and reducing the frequency of maintenance, they contribute to overall cost savings.

Applications of Split Bearings in Stacker-Reclaimers
1. Slewing Rings
The slewing ring of a stacker-reclaimer is one of the most critical parts of the machine, allowing it to rotate and move material. Split bearings are ideal for this application, as they can withstand high rotational speeds and heavy loads while remaining easy to maintain.

2. Boom Joints and Elevation Mechanisms
The boom of a stacker-reclaimer is responsible for lifting and lowering the material stack. Split bearings used in the boom joints or elevation mechanisms allow smooth motion and greater load distribution, ensuring consistent performance.

3. Conveyor Systems
In the conveyor sections of the stacker-reclaimer, split bearings are used in various rollers, pulleys, and drive shafts. These components are under constant stress from the weight of the material being handled and the wear and tear from continuous motion. Split bearings provide the reliability needed to keep the conveyor systems running smoothly.

Best Practices for Using Split Bearings in Stacker-Reclaimers
Regular Inspections: Even though split bearings reduce maintenance time, regular inspection is essential to detect any wear, contamination, or misalignment.

Lubrication: Proper lubrication is key to maximizing the lifespan of split bearings. Ensure that the bearings are properly greased to reduce friction and prevent premature wear.

Choosing the Right Split Bearing: When selecting a split bearing, it’s important to match the bearing type and size to the specific requirements of the stacker-reclaimer, considering factors like load, speed, and environmental conditions.

Professional Installation: While split bearings are designed for easier installation, it’s still important that they are installed correctly to avoid misalignment, which could lead to premature failure.
